CVE-2022-26616 describes a reflected c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ability affecting PKP Open Journal System versions 2.4.8 through 3.3.8, allowing attackers to inject malicious scripts via crafted HTTP headers. This medium-severity vulnerability (CVSS 6.1) requires user interaction (UI:R) and can lead to limited confidentiality and integrity impacts (C:L/I:L) without affecting availability. There is currently no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code (Metasploit, Nuclei, ExploitDB), or significant community discussion surrounding this CVE.
